Simplicial $q$-connectivity of directed graphs with applications to network analysis

Abstract: Directed graphs are ubiquitous models for networks, and topological spaces they generate, such as the directed flag complex, have become useful objects in applied topology. The simplices are formed from directed cliques. We extend Atkin's theory of q-connectivity to the case of directed simplices. This results in a preorder where simplices are related by sequences of simplices that share a q-face with respect to directions specified by chosen face maps.
